In what way can you choose taste and scent combinations?

How does one select the perfect flavor and scent pairings for custom lip balm? Opting for flavor and scent combinations requires a balance between personal preference and market trends. One effective approach is to take into account popular pairings, such as vanilla with mint or citrus mixes like lemon and orange. These pairings usually suggest freshness and appeal to a broad audience.

Additionally, seasonal themes can inspire decisions; for instance, warm spices like cinnamon and clove might be favored in autumn, while light florals or fruity notes stand out in warmer months. Experimentation plays a crucial role; mixing small batches allows for testing how flavors and scents combine.

Moreover, it’s important to remember the target audience. Choices might vary between demographics, so understanding the intended users can steer the selection. Ultimately, the perfect combination should resonate with personal taste while also appealing to potential customers.

Crucial Elements for Nourishing Unique Lip Balm

Nourishing personalized lip balm is based on a blend of vital ingredients that encourage moisture and protection. Key components typically include botanical oils such as coconut, almond, or jojoba, which provide hydration and help to smooth the lips. Beeswax serves as a thickening agent, creating a layer that locks in hydration while allowing the balm to glide smoothly on the lips.

Additionally, shea and cocoa are often included for their luxurious emollient properties, enhancing the balm's ability to soothe and nourish dry lips. Natural oils, like peppermint or lavender, can be added for fragrance and subtle therapeutic benefits. Vitamin E is also a popular choice, offering antioxidant properties that support skin health. Together, these ingredients create a harmonious blend that not only hydrates but also nourishes and protects, making custom lip balm a delightful addition to any beauty routine.

The Advantages of Adding Skincare Ingredients to Your Lip Balm

Incorporating skincare ingredients into lip balm can significantly enhance its effectiveness, offering more than just hydration. Ingredients like vitamin E, shea butter, and jojoba oil not only moisturize but also provide essential nutrients that promote lip health. Vitamin E, known for its antioxidant properties, helps protect against environmental damage, while shea butter acts as a natural barrier, sealing in moisture and preventing dryness.

What’s more, plant-based extracts such as calendula or chamomile can ease irritation and foster healing, making lip balm perfect for sensitive lips. The use of natural oils also enhances texture, providing a soft application and a silken feel. Moreover, some ingredients furnish sun protection, creating an supplementary layer of defense against harmful UV rays. In summary, the deliberate addition of skincare components converts ordinary lip balm into a multi-use treatment, upgrading its function in daily beauty routines.

Pricing Considerations In Each

Though the draw of crafting a homemade lip balm at home is attractive, a careful look at expense factors highlights significant differences between DIY choices and commercial alternatives. Making your own lip balm demands an initial investment in components like oils, waxes, and flavorings, which may increase over time. Costs can rise depending on the grade and volume of materials, especially for specialty ingredients. Conversely, retail lip balms offer convenience and quick access, often at a economical initial price. Nevertheless, premium brands might be costly, particularly those highlighting organic or special formulations. Ultimately, individuals must weigh the initial costs and long-term savings of DIY against the convenience and variety offered by commercial products to determine the most suitable option for their needs.

How much time will custom Lip Balm commonly remain effective once unsealed?

Custom lip balm, once unsealed, generally lasts about six months to a year, depending on the ingredients and storage circumstances. Correct sealing and preventing contamination can help lengthen its shelf life significantly for users.

Can allergens be regularly present in Lip Balms?

Many lip balms contain regular allergens such as beeswax, shea butter, fragrance, and select oils. Individuals with sensitivities need to carefully read ingredient labels to avoid reactions and guarantee a safe product choice.

Is Personalized Lip Balm Appropriate for Fragile Skin?

Custom lip balm may be well-suited for sensitive skin, assuming it contains gentle, hypoallergenic ingredients. Users should review formulations, avoiding known irritants, to ensure compatibility with their unique skin sensitivities and preferences.

How long can homemade balm keep quality?

Homemade lip moisturizer regularly has a shelf life of six months to one year, depending on the elements employed. Proper storage in a cool, dark place can help extend its longevity and maintain effectiveness.
